When choosing a Medicare Advantage Plan, it's crucial to consider the following:

  1. Network Restrictions: Ensure that preferred doctors and hospitals are included in the plan's network.
  2. Prescription Drug Coverage: Verify that necessary medications are covered under the plan's formulary.
  3. Out-of-Pocket Maximum: Understand the maximum amount you may have to pay in a year, as this can impact overall affordability.
  4. Plan Flexibility: Consider whether the plan allows for out-of-network coverage and under what conditions.

These factors can significantly influence the overall satisfaction and financial feasibility of a Medicare Advantage Plan.
